KARACHI: PMC students clinch top positions


KARACHI, Dec 20: The students of Peoples Medical College (PMC), Nawabshah bagged two top positions in the 9th Proficiency Evaluation Test (PET) 2005, organized by the PMA Science and Health Council for senior medical students.

The PET’s countrywide test was held in 11 different cities and students from 14 medical colleges participated in the test. Reena Kumari of the Peoples Medical College, Nawabshah secured the first position, while Abida Kanwal and Sana Soobia of the same college shared the second position.

The third position went jointly to Sudham Chand of the Chandka Medical College, Larkana and Irfan Zeb of the Nishtar Medical College, Multan. Complete results are being displayed at the PMA, National Headquarters, Garden Road, Karachi. —PPI
